ALFA Romeo Spider oil change
Well it was high time I changed the engine oil and filter in my 1986 ALFA Romeo Spider Graduate so this morning I set about the task.
Really it is relatively simple, with all the bits within easy reach and access. Amazing the little 1962cc 4 cylinder engine takes 7.1 quarts of oil! The oil filter is very large as well, as you will see in the photos below which compare it to the filter my Moto Guzzis take, which are the same size as a normal car filter.
Below you will see the airbox, which contains the air filter and atop which sits the air flow metering device, which senses and controls the volume of air entering the engine. The airbox is removed (3 bolts) to gain easier access to the oil filter.
So now she's all filled with fresh clean 20w50 weight oil and a new filter. Happy Spider :)
